- Sort Score
- Result 10 results
- Languages All
Results 1 - 10 of 3,188 for KtType (0.24 sec)
-
analysis/analysis-api-fe10/src/org/jetbrains/kotlin/analysis/api/descriptors/components/KtFe10TypeProvider.kt
require(type is KtFe10Type) return typeApproximator.approximateToSuperType(type.fe10Type, PublicApproximatorConfiguration(approximateLocalTypes)) ?.toKtType(analysisContext) } override fun approximateToSubPublicDenotableType(type: KtType, approximateLocalTypes: Boolean): KtType? { require(type is KtFe10Type)
Plain Text - Registered: Fri Apr 26 08:18:10 GMT 2024 - Last Modified: Mon Jan 29 09:37:59 GMT 2024 - 23.3K bytes - Viewed (0) -
analysis/analysis-api-fe10/src/org/jetbrains/kotlin/analysis/api/descriptors/signatures/KtFe10VariableLikeSignature.kt
import org.jetbrains.kotlin.analysis.api.types.KtSubstitutor import org.jetbrains.kotlin.analysis.api.types.KtType internal class KtFe10VariableLikeSignature<out S : KtVariableLikeSymbol>( private val backingSymbol: S, private val backingReturnType: KtType, private val backingReceiverType: KtType?, ) : KtVariableLikeSignature<S>() { override val token: KtLifetimeToken get() = backingSymbol.token
Plain Text - Registered: Fri Apr 26 08:18:10 GMT 2024 - Last Modified: Thu Apr 25 18:05:58 GMT 2024 - 2.1K bytes - Viewed (0) -
analysis/analysis-api-fir/src/org/jetbrains/kotlin/analysis/api/fir/components/KtFirExpressionTypeProvider.kt
expression.isWhileLoopCondition() || expression.isIfCondition() -> with(analysisSession) { builtinTypes.BOOLEAN } else -> null } private fun getExpectedTypeByVariableAssignment(expression: PsiElement): KtType? { // Given: `x = expression` // Expected type of `expression` is type of `x` val assignmentExpression =
Plain Text - Registered: Fri Apr 26 08:18:10 GMT 2024 - Last Modified: Tue Mar 26 18:13:17 GMT 2024 - 24.4K bytes - Viewed (0) -
analysis/analysis-api-fe10/src/org/jetbrains/kotlin/analysis/api/descriptors/components/KtFe10SubtypingComponent.kt
import org.jetbrains.kotlin.analysis.api.types.KtType internal class KtFe10SubtypingComponent( override val analysisSession: KtFe10AnalysisSession ) : KtSubtypingComponent(), Fe10KtAnalysisSessionComponent { override val token: KtLifetimeToken get() = analysisSession.token override fun isEqualTo(first: KtType, second: KtType): Boolean { require(first is KtFe10Type)
Plain Text - Registered: Fri Apr 26 08:18:10 GMT 2024 - Last Modified: Tue Jan 10 12:54:17 GMT 2023 - 1.5K bytes - Viewed (0) -
analysis/analysis-api-fir/src/org/jetbrains/kotlin/analysis/api/fir/components/KtFirSubtypingComponent.kt
import org.jetbrains.kotlin.analysis.api.types.KtType import org.jetbrains.kotlin.types.AbstractTypeChecker internal class KtFirSubtypingComponent( override val analysisSession: KtFirAnalysisSession, override val token: KtLifetimeToken, ) : KtSubtypingComponent(), KtFirAnalysisSessionComponent { override fun isEqualTo(first: KtType, second: KtType): Boolean { second.assertIsValidAndAccessible()
Plain Text - Registered: Fri Apr 26 08:18:10 GMT 2024 - Last Modified: Wed Jun 22 07:31:36 GMT 2022 - 1.6K bytes - Viewed (0) -
analysis/analysis-api-fir/src/org/jetbrains/kotlin/analysis/api/fir/components/KtFirSubstitutorFactory.kt
Plain Text - Registered: Fri Apr 26 08:18:10 GMT 2024 - Last Modified: Wed Mar 06 06:40:28 GMT 2024 - 1.9K bytes - Viewed (0) -
analysis/analysis-api-fir/src/org/jetbrains/kotlin/analysis/api/fir/components/KtFirTypeProvider.kt
return typeArguments.firstOrNull()?.type } override fun withNullability(type: KtType, newNullability: KtTypeNullability): KtType { require(type is KtFirType) return type.coneType.withNullability(newNullability.toConeNullability(), rootModuleSession.typeContext).asKtType() } override fun haveCommonSubtype(a: KtType, b: KtType): Boolean {
Plain Text - Registered: Fri Apr 26 08:18:10 GMT 2024 - Last Modified: Tue Feb 20 08:50:04 GMT 2024 - 16.3K bytes - Viewed (0) -
analysis/analysis-api-fe10/src/org/jetbrains/kotlin/analysis/api/descriptors/components/KtFe10ExpressionTypeProvider.kt
// we want full Array<out T> type for parity with FIR implementation bindingContext[BindingContext.VALUE_PARAMETER, declaration]?.returnType } else { bindingContext[BindingContext.TYPE, typeReference] } ?: ErrorUtils.createErrorType(ErrorTypeKind.RETURN_TYPE, typeReference.text)
Plain Text - Registered: Fri Apr 26 08:18:10 GMT 2024 - Last Modified: Tue Oct 24 20:59:56 GMT 2023 - 15.5K bytes - Viewed (0) -
analysis/analysis-api-fe10/src/org/jetbrains/kotlin/analysis/api/descriptors/components/KtFe10PsiTypeProvider.kt
KtTypeMappingMode.RETURN_TYPE_BOXED -> TypeMappingMode.RETURN_TYPE_BOXED KtTypeMappingMode.RETURN_TYPE -> typeMapper.typeContext.getOptimalModeForReturnType(type.fe10Type, isAnnotationMethod) KtTypeMappingMode.VALUE_PARAMETER -> typeMapper.typeContext.getOptimalModeForValueParameter(type.fe10Type) }.let { typeMappingMode ->
Plain Text - Registered: Fri Apr 26 08:18:10 GMT 2024 - Last Modified: Thu Mar 28 16:10:07 GMT 2024 - 6.4K bytes - Viewed (0) -
analysis/analysis-api-fe10/src/org/jetbrains/kotlin/analysis/api/descriptors/types/KtFe10DefinitelyNotNullType.kt
import org.jetbrains.kotlin.analysis.api.descriptors.types.base.asStringForDebugging import org.jetbrains.kotlin.analysis.api.types.KtDefinitelyNotNullType import org.jetbrains.kotlin.analysis.api.types.KtType import org.jetbrains.kotlin.analysis.api.lifetime.withValidityAssertion import org.jetbrains.kotlin.types.DefinitelyNotNullType internal class KtFe10DefinitelyNotNullType( override val fe10Type: DefinitelyNotNullType,
Plain Text - Registered: Fri Apr 26 08:18:10 GMT 2024 - Last Modified: Thu Jan 12 10:48:21 GMT 2023 - 1.3K bytes - Viewed (0)